A great combination hunting and grazing tract in the Gyp Hills of Unit #16, this property offers tillable fields, timbered draws, and a rural water tank which is perfect for giant bucks and large coveys of quail. While the grass has been grazed over the years, it is currently in great shape and it is open for leasing or grazing for the new owner to do whatever is desired. A total of 55 acres of Class II soils, currently in milo, the tillable produces good crops each year and adds additional income to the property. There are great quail numbers on this property and with the continuation of milo in the tillable fields it will only get better. The deer quality in this area is exceptional due to the genetics and age structure. This ranch is surrounded by several large ranches, most of which have limited hunting pressure and have been known to produce top end deer. Just to the east of the ranch lies Mule Creek which runs along the Barber County and Comanche County border and is well known to be a hot producing area for man many years. Part of a larger 1,600 acre ranch there is an option to purchase more acres that have additional tillable and grazing for extra income.
